Handover on the Marrowset session-token refresh bug: tokens issued near the hourly rotation window sometimes fail to refresh, logging users out of the Ledgerline console. A patch is staged behind the rotation-grace flag and needs soak time before the next release. Keep the flag off in production until QA confirms no duplicate-session regressions. Test results, flag state history, and the rollout plan are tracked on the internal page below.

dashboard of tahag-bajef = https://confluence.zemvarlabs.internal/projects/pages/projects/f53ad3f4

## Catalogue Cache Environments

Shelfmark's product catalog cache has separate invalidation behavior per environment. Dev invalidates on every write for simplicity; staging batches invalidations every 30 seconds; prod uses event-driven purges from the inventory stream. Last week's stale-price incident traced back to a dropped purge event, so we added a sweep job in prod. For this week's sync, note the prod service runs with these values.

settings of bafof-fajog:
[aldix]
port = 9300
region = north-3
host = aldix.kelvilabs.example
team = istath
timeout_ms = 1500
retries = 8

Finance Review Summary — Loyalty Programme Overhaul, Bramleigh Retail Group

The proposed replacement of the StarPoints scheme with the tiered Bramleigh Circle programme carries an estimated first-year cost increase of 4.1%, driven by redemption liability and system migration. Modelling suggests repeat-visit revenue offsets this by quarter five. Branch managers should verify local redemption data before month-end to support the final business case. Please treat the appended note as strictly confidential.

board note of kafog-bajep: Briathek Partners is in early talks to buy Aldaelek Group for about $47.1 million. The Ulaath launch date is September 4, and nothing goes to the press before then.

### Compressing Telemetry Payloads

The Quillbright ingest API accepts gzip and zstd; set Content-Encoding accordingly. Payloads over 256 KB uncompressed are rejected, so batch and compress before sending. Zstd level 3 is the recommended tradeoff for our typical sensor batches. All ingest calls require authorization; for your contractor sandbox, include the bearer token shown below.

session JWT of yawep-yawep = eyJhbGciOiJIUzI1NiIsInR5cCI6IkpXVCJ9.eyJzdWIiOiI3pWF3_In0.aXYsHiog